This Course in a Nutshell

Stress Management is one of the most valuable skillsets one can learn in life, to preserve one's health and wellbeing. This course teaches you how to identify negative stress and to put the correct strategies in place to eliminate the debilitating effects of stress.

Course Overview

In this course we take you through a series of processes to help you first identify negative stress and create sustainable strategies to assist you in combatting its negative effects. These include everything from time management to applying required boundaries for managing commitments before they turn into stressful situations. We emphasize that whereas not all stress may not have readily available solutions, the individuals reaction to any situation is what determines the impact.

About the Author

Ches Moulton, The Stress Master, is the UK’s leading authority on stress management.

His career has spanned more than 25 years, during which time he has been a much sought-after executive coach, psychotherapist, and trainer. His most recent work has focused on helping those with elevated levels of stress overcome their problems and enjoy productive lives, free from both the physical and mental consequences of chronic stress.

During his time as a business performance consultant, Ches has served as an advisor to both private businesses and government in Canada, the Caribbean, United Kingdom, Africa and the Middle East.

He is the author of ‘How to get control of your stress instead of stress controlling you’, and the international best-seller ‘Choice and Change - How to have a healthy relationship with ourself and others’. 

Ches is a member of his local chamber of commerce. He also serves on boards and committees, both locally and regionally.
